Job Description

Key responsibilities:

  • Work collaboratively with top engineers & data architects across Microsoft to drive effective technical solutions.
  • Coordinate with Microsoft Digital and PG leadership in project and strategy reviews
  • Driving the company’s strategy and technical/data architecture for key technologies to achieve cross-company goals and alignment
  • Architect, design, develop, and deliver high quality software that powers ever increasing demands of availability, reliability, security and performance of IT core tools.
  • Stay on top of industry trends, standards from security and scalability perspective to Lead and influence design decisions to build services right ground up.
  • Driving code and design reviews and take them closure

Qualifications

Knowledge, experience and skills:

  • Should have a Computer Science or related degree; BS or MS degree in Computer Science or related engineering discipline.
  • Strong understanding of fundamentals of Computer Science; Data Engineering, Databases – SQL Server and/or any Competitor DBMS System
  • 5+ years of hands-on experience in building - Data Engineering frameworks, Data Warehouse, Data Pipeline, Data Lake, Data Analytics & Business Intelligence
  • Proficient hands-on experience in building applications using Python, SQL/PLSQL, JSON, XML
  • 5+ years software development experience in full product cycle: design, development, release and maintenance.
  • Familiarity with Microsoft .NET technologies (C# and the .NET Framework) and/or competitive offerings (e.g. J2EE, WebLogic or WebSphere).

            Experience should entail some or all the below:

  • 3+ years of experience delivering scalable and resilient services at large enterprise scale.
  • Understanding on basic Machine Learning Techniques – Regression, Classification, Clustering, Decision Tress, Time Series Analysis (to name a few)
  • 4+ years of experience in data platforms including large-scale analytics on relational, structured and unstructured data

Preferred, not required:

  • Strong Azure Dev Ops (formerly Visual Studio Team Services).
  • Experience with Agile project management techniques.
  • Passion for using data and analytics to drive business insights & value.
  • Understanding of Statistical Modeling & Data Distribution
  • Excellent interpersonal, team collaboration and group dynamic skills
  • Able to execute tasks with minimal supervision
  • Strong written & verbal communication and presentation skills

 

Describe the ideal candidate (optional)

Successful candidate must have deep technical aptitude, great communication and cross-group skills, strong customer focus, a can-do and ready-to-learn attitude and the ability to jump in and get the job done in a fast-paced and stimulating environment. Will have experience working in a high-performing team environment, experience running and designing enterprise scale services and platforms, technical depth in cloud platforms, agile development practices, and experience in designing & tuning telemetry.
